Saxophone and Dj on Wedding by CartoonistDouble5941 in saxophone

[–]Snoo95176 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I play with DJs quite often and DJ+Sax myself. A lot of it is improvising and often having to really use your ears for tuning as tempos might be different.
What has helped me is getting an idea of the setlist or songs first so that you can learn any iconic horn lines, also try not to play over the vocals, don't feel like you have to play all the time (it's like chocolate cake, too much ruins a good thing). The other thing is just chuck on some youtube DJ mixes or even a spotify playlist and just practise jamming along.

Once you get used to it it can be a whole lot of fun, good luck!
